Ingredients

Luxuriously creamy no-bake dessert with Nutella and Oreo layers.

For the Crust

  • 200g crushed Oreos
  • 50g melted butter

For the Filling

  • 500g cream cheese, softened
  • 200g Nutella
  • 200g heavy whipping cream (35%)
  • 50g sugar
  • 100g chopped Oreos

For Drizzling and Garnish

  • 100g Nutella, warmed for drizzling
  • 5 crushed Oreos (no filling)
  • 6 whole Oreos for garnish

How to Make No Bake Oreo Nutella Cheesecake

Step 1: Prepare the Crust

  1. Crush Oreos into fine crumbs.
  2. Mix with melted butter until the texture resembles wet sand.
  3. Press this mixture into a springform pan.
  4. Freeze while you prepare the filling.

Step 2: Make the Filling

  1. Soften the cream cheese in a bowl.
  2. Add Nutella and mix until smooth.
  3. In another chilled bowl, whip heavy cream with sugar until soft peaks form.
  4. Gently fold whipped cream into the Nutella-cream cheese mixture.

Step 3: Assemble the Cheesecake

  1. Carefully fold in chopped Oreos into the filling mixture.
  2. Pour half of this filling onto your crust; smooth it out evenly.
  3. Drizzle some warmed Nutella over this layer.
  4. Top with remaining filling and smooth out again.

Step 4: Chill the Cheesecake

  1. Refrigerate your cheesecake for at least 8 hours or overnight to set properly.

Step 5: Garnish Before Serving

  1. Spread a thin layer of warmed Nutella on top before serving.
  2. Sprinkle with crushed Oreos and place whole Oreos around as garnish.
  3. Drizzle more Nutella to finish off before slicing into servings.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Avoiding common pitfalls can elevate your No Bake Oreo Nutella Cheesecake to perfection. Here are some mistakes to watch out for:

  • Not crushing Oreos finely enough: Ensure you crush the Oreos into fine crumbs. This helps create a firm crust that holds together well.

  • Using cold cream cheese: Always soften your cream cheese before mixing. Cold cream cheese can create lumps in your filling, making it less creamy.

  • Over-whipping the cream: Whip the heavy cream only until soft peaks form. Over-whipping can lead to a grainy texture instead of the desired lightness.

  • Skipping refrigeration time: Don’t rush the chilling process. Refrigerating the cheesecake for at least 8 hours allows it to set properly and enhances flavor.

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store the No Bake Oreo Nutella Cheesecake in an airtight container.
  • It will keep well in the refrigerator for up to 5 days.
  • If possible, place parchment paper between layers to avoid sticking.

Freezing No Bake Oreo Nutella Cheesecake

  • Wrap individual slices tightly in plastic wrap before freezing.
  • The cheesecake can be frozen for up to 3 months.
  • Thaw it overnight in the refrigerator before serving for best results.
